Shelter Cymru exists to defend the right to a safe home in Wales and fight the devastating impact the housing emergency has on people.
We help thousands of people each year by offering free, confidential and independent advice and campaigning to overcome the root causes of the housing emergency.

An exciting opportunity has now arisen at Shelter Cymru for a Housing Law Caseworker who will work within our Housing Services team based in North Wales at either our Wrexham, Rhyl or Felinheli offices.
The post holder will be part of a team who provide a National Housing Advice Service. In this role advice will be delivered primarily via telephone. The postholder may also be required to provide cover at face to face advice-based surgeys and at housing possessesion help desks in courts across North Wales.
